WHY is the Indian national flag hoisted at sunrise and brought down at sunset?

0

It was my understanding that is the general treatment of ANY country’s flag in the respective country. And the idea is to keep it protected. It is still cloth, and so it wears and tears and so forth. Taking it down, especially in colder temperatures or in bad weather, keeps it in acceptable condition much longer. It is nothing more than respect for the symbol of one’s country.
